Not many people were around back then, but once upon a time there was a working version of Scuttlebot (by Dominic Tarr) that was documented at https://scuttlebot.io/ with a client called Patchwork (by Paul Frazee). The idea behind the project was that you would gossip between scuttlebot 'pub' servers and then replicate messages from the people you follow and the people that those people follow.... - Source: Hacker News / about 1 year ago

"Scuttlebot" seems to be the old name for the primary Secure Scuttlebutt server implementation (https://handbook.scuttlebutt.nz/glossary), though its website is still https://scuttlebot.io/. - Source: Hacker News / about 1 year ago
